I once found a long. lost relative by contacting the DMV, paying $5.00, and waiting two weeks. Forms can be sent in the mail and use the last known address, even if it is your own. Explain this is a family matter and they will usually send it to you in the mail. DMV says it will notify your son of your interest, but they rarely ever do. If this doesn't work, try the Salvation Army and request they do a search. Explain this is a family emergency. Best of luck. Carol |
